ACAR Conductor

An outer layer of Aluminum conductor concentrically stranded over the central core of solid Aluminum alloy or Stranded Aluminum alloy wire to form ACAR conductor.

STANDARDS

  • ASTM B524,IEC61089.

CONSTRUCTION

  • This bare concentric-lay stranded conductor is made from round aluminum 1350-H19 (extra hard) wires and round aluminum-alloy 6201-T81 core wires for use as overhead electrical conductors.
  • These conductors are also manufactured as compact conductors if required.

APPLICATION

  • ACAR–Conductor02

    Bare overhead conductor used as transmission cable and as primary and secondary distribution cable. A good strength-toweight ratio makes ACAR applicable where both ampacity and strength are prime considerations in line design; for equal weight, ACAR offers higher stength and ampacity than ACSR.ACAR wires have the characteristics of adapting to high altitude, rainy years, and cold conditions, and are suitable for power transmission in mountainous areas and the construction of earth power equipment.
